Arguments multiples
Dans l'exercice précédent, vous avez identifié les arguments optionnels en consultant la documentation avec help()
. Vous allez maintenant l'appliquer pour modifier le comportement de la fonction sorted()
.
Consultez la documentation de sorted()
en saisissant help(sorted)
dans le shell IPython.
Vous verrez que sorted()
prend trois arguments : iterable
, key
, et reverse
. Dans cet exercice, vous ne devrez spécifier que iterable
et reverse
, et non key
.
Deux listes ont été créées pour vous.
Pouvez-vous les coller ensemble et les trier par ordre décroissant ?
Cet exercice fait partie du cours
Introduction à Python
Instructions
- Utilisez
+
pour fusionner le contenu defirst
etsecond
dans une nouvelle liste :full
. - Appelez
sorted()
surfull
et spécifiez que l'argumentreverse
estTrue
. Enregistrez la liste triée sousfull_sorted
. - Terminez en affichant
full_sorted
.
Exercice interactif pratique
Essayez cet exercice en complétant cet exemple de code.
# Create lists first and second
first = [11.25, 18.0, 20.0]
second = [10.75, 9.50]
# Paste together first and second: full
full = ____ + ____
# Sort full in descending order: full_sorted
full_sorted = ____
# Print out full_sorted
____